The pharmaceutical industry has made tremendous efforts in developing diabetic drugs to help patients maintain normal blood sugar levels. These drugs undergo various diabetic trials to determine their effectiveness in controlling the disease. It is also important for patients to understand their responsibilities during these trials. Below, we have listed a few key points that can help make a diabetic trial more efficient and successful.
- These patients should follow strict diet schedule as mentioned in the protocol. Diet could be of high calorie or low calorie. Some studies could be of high fat diet and others could be of Low fat diet depending upon the protocol.
- A diabetic patients should follow his drug schedule very strictly so that he has actually impact of drug on the body and the results are accurate whether they give positive or negative impact.
- Patients should follow the clinical trial protocol for exercise. If unclear, they should ask the Principal Investigator or Clinical Research Coordinator. - Another important thing is that patients with diabetes generally has concomitant disease which may be of cardio-thoracic, kidney disease, liver disease etc. It is important for him to inform Principal Investigator about his status so that he can make right judgment about his enrolment in the study.
- It is important for clinical trial that patient should have regular and on time followed up. If patients follow up is regular then there will be less of patient’s failure during clinical trial follow up and one should have excellent result during their clinical trials.
These are some of the points that one should remember while participating in diabetes trial. These are critical points that can help a trial to be successful and efficient.
